Xena provides comprehensive notetaking services for your team, including support for hybrid and in-person meetings. For best results, consider microphone placement and room acoustics.

How to get a Summary for your in-person meeting:

  1. Schedule a Meeting: Set up a meeting that includes a Zoom or GMeet conferencing link.

  2. Invite Guests: Include all individuals you expect to join the meeting in the invitation.

  3. Meeting Setup: At the start of the in-person session, initiate the call by accessing the conferencing link on a laptop or phone with the microphone activated.

  4. Admit the Notetaker: Ensure the notetaker gains access to the call promptly.

Tips for a successful Summary of your in-person meeting:

  1. Include Attendee Emails: Add the email addresses of all expected participants to the calendar event. This enables Xena to identify speakers accurately.

  2. Optimal Microphone Positioning: Ensure the laptop microphone faces forward, with all participants positioned in front of the device and in close proximity.

  3. Choose a Room with Good Acoustics: Use a meeting space with good acoustics to enhance audio quality.

๐Ÿ’ก Pro tip: For superior audio quality, use an external omnidirectional microphone in the center of the room. This significantly enhances the transcript and resulting Summary.

Watch out: Add at least one guest to the meeting invite to ensure Summary is enabled. The notetaker won't attempt to join events with no attendees.
